im confused!!!! which megasquirt do u have because the megasquirt 2 has an internal 2.5 bar map sensor. tuning for exhaust temp isnt going to do u an good. to properly tune you need to tune based on engine load. you need to tune using tps, rpm, load(map sensor) and wideband o2.

i have the 2.5 and i am using tps.rpm map and wideband. But i know on others engines that the exhaust temps are used to give you a clue of what is happening in the cylinder. watching the temp can tell you if something is going wrong. I have not hooked up the sensors yet but the plan is to, not for tuning but for reference.
